Dive into the Fascinating World of Algorithm Mastery with Learning Algorithms by George Heineman
Delve into the enchanting realm of algorithms and discover the transformative power they hold in shaping our digital world. George Heineman's seminal work, "Learning Algorithms," is an essential guide for anyone seeking to comprehend the intricate tapestry of algorithms that drive our technological advancements.
Chapter 1: The Essence of Algorithms
4.3 out of 5
Language | : | English |
File size | : | 20867 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 280 pages |
Embark on an illuminating journey that unveils the fundamental nature of algorithms. Unravel the concept of time and space complexity, the pillars upon which algorithms are measured and optimized. Understand the diverse range of algorithm design paradigms, from divide-and-conquer to dynamic programming.
Chapter 2: From Theory to Practice
Witness the transition of theoretical algorithms into real-world applications. Explore classic algorithms such as binary search, sorting techniques, and graph algorithms, delving into their practical implementation and efficiency considerations. Gain a hands-on perspective on the intricate interplay between algorithms and programming.
Chapter 3: Dynamic Programming
Uncover the power of dynamic programming, a technique that empowers algorithms to solve complex problems by leveraging insights from previous computations. Discover the applications of dynamic programming in diverse domains, such as bioinformatics, speech recognition, and network optimization.
Chapter 4: Greedy Algorithms
Delve into the realm of greedy algorithms, a class of approaches that make locally optimal choices to achieve an overall solution. Examine the trade-offs and limitations of greedy algorithms, and witness their applications in areas such as resource allocation, scheduling, and clustering.
Chapter 5: Divide-and-Conquer
Master the divide-and-conquer paradigm, a powerful divide-and-rule strategy for tackling complex problems. Explore algorithms such as merge sort, binary search, and quicksort, and unravel the recursive nature of this algorithm design technique.
Chapter 6: Graph Algorithms
Enter the world of graphs, abstract structures that model relationships between entities. Discover fundamental graph algorithms, including depth-first search, breadth-first search, and shortest path algorithms, and their applications in areas such as network management, search engines, and computer vision.
Chapter 7: Heuristic Algorithms
Venture into the realm of heuristic algorithms, a category of techniques that provide approximate solutions when exact solutions are elusive or computationally intensive. Explore the concepts of hill climbing, simulated annealing, and genetic algorithms, and their applications in complex problem domains.
Chapter 8: Beyond Elementary Algorithms
Expand your algorithmic horizons beyond the foundational concepts. Explore advanced topics such as approximation algorithms, parallel algorithms, and randomized algorithms, and gain an appreciation for the challenges and breakthroughs in algorithmic research.
"Learning Algorithms" by George Heineman is an indispensable resource for anyone seeking a comprehensive understanding of algorithms and their transformative impact on our digital age. From theoretical foundations to practical applications, this book empowers readers to navigate the complex world of algorithms with confidence and mastery. Embrace the knowledge within its pages, and unlock the potential of algorithms to empower your own technological creations.
Call to Action
Embark on your algorithmic adventure today! Free Download "Learning Algorithms" by George Heineman and unlock the transformative power of algorithms. Join the ranks of algorithm enthusiasts and harness the knowledge to shape the future of our digital world.
4.3 out of 5
Language | : | English |
File size | : | 20867 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 280 pages |
Do you want to contribute by writing guest posts on this blog?
Please contact us and send us a resume of previous articles that you have written.
- Book
- Novel
- Page
- Chapter
- Text
- Story
- Genre
- Reader
- Library
- Paperback
- E-book
- Magazine
- Newspaper
- Paragraph
- Sentence
- Bookmark
- Shelf
- Glossary
- Bibliography
- Foreword
- Preface
- Synopsis
- Annotation
- Footnote
- Manuscript
- Scroll
- Codex
- Tome
- Bestseller
- Classics
- Library card
- Narrative
- Biography
- Autobiography
- Memoir
- Reference
- Encyclopedia
- Jacqueline Mika
- George Joshua
- Harley Mcallister
- Max Muller
- Tanya Mulroy
- Ghada Karmi
- Gary Taubes
- Patrick Hamill
- Jamaury Day
- Eleanor Herman
- Ed Gaulden
- Rangarajan K Sundaram
- Heather Jacobson
- Heather M Dakin
- Don Casey
- Eve Vaughn
- Delaney Diamond
- Nick O Hern
- Kengo Sakurada
- Georg Rauch
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!
- Samuel WardFollow ·16k
- Mario SimmonsFollow ·17.5k
- Michael ChabonFollow ·3.7k
- Aron CoxFollow ·6.5k
- Rudyard KiplingFollow ·18k
- Herman MitchellFollow ·9.6k
- Hugh ReedFollow ·15.1k
- Shawn ReedFollow ·13.3k
Unveiling Humanism in China and the West: A Journey...
In our rapidly...
Blind Boy's Unwavering Struggle Against Abuse and the...
In the tapestry of...
Building Wealth While Working for Uncle Sam: The Ultimate...
## ### Are you a federal employee who wants...
Unveiling the Secrets of Arabic Survival: The Ultimate...
Embarking on a journey to unravel the...
4.3 out of 5
Language | : | English |
File size | : | 20867 KB |
Text-to-Speech | : | Enabled |
Screen Reader | : | Supported |
Enhanced typesetting | : | Enabled |
Print length | : | 280 pages |